Official statutory text
A fee of ten dollars ($10) shall be paid to the secretary before the filing of each petition for a special rate of assessment. The money shall be applied to the cost of the publication of the notice and other expenses of the hearing. If there is any balance after the conclusion of the hearing, it shall be returned to the petitioner or divided among the petitioners contributing thereto in proportion to the respective areas described in their petitions.
